Top floor apartment located in the highly sought-after, converted Dedham Mill, in the heart of Dedham and on the banks of the beautiful River Stour. Accommodation comprises kitchen, living / dining room with superb river views, balcony, bedroom with walk-in wardrobe and a bathroom. The property also benefits from access to communal grounds, river mooring and a designated parking space.

This bright and well-proportioned top floor apartment enjoys a prime position within Dedham Mill, offering far-reaching views across the River Stour and surrounding countryside. Set within this iconic converted building, the apartment provides a rare combination of seclusion, character and convenience in the heart of Constable Country.
Accessed by lift, the property opens into a private entrance hall leading to a generously sized sitting room with large windows and French doors that open onto a covered balcony. This elevated vantage point offers uninterrupted, picture-perfect views of the river and the lush landscape beyond, making it an exceptional space to relax or unwind. The adjoining kitchen is well laid out, with natural light flooding in from a central skylight, and provides ample space for all essential appliances.
The bedroom features distinctive architecture with a sloped ceiling and wide dormer window that frames more beautiful views, creating a peaceful and atmospheric retreat. A walk-in wardrobe offers excellent storage, and the adjacent shower room is smartly presented with contemporary fittings and a walk-in enclosure.
Residents of Dedham Mill benefit from access to well-maintained meadowland and a private mooring on the River Stour, adding to the lifestyle appeal of this unique riverside setting. Secure off-street parking is provided within the development, along with well-kept communal areas and landscaped grounds.
Located just a short walk from the centre of Dedham, with its independent shops, cafes and historic parish church, the property also offers excellent road access to both Colchester and Ipswich, making it ideal as a full-time residence or peaceful weekend retreat.
